TiVo Brings Brightcove Content to Regular Television

DVR service provider TiVo and internet TV provider Brightcove will bring online video content into the living room through the set-top TiVo DVR. The two companies will bring various video content providers on-board over the next several months, gradually expanding the amount of downloadable TiVo content.

Eventually, anyone who publishes online video will be able to deliver their content to TiVo subscribers through Brightcove’s publishing system. Both companies see as an opportunity for online video providers to generate revenue through advertising, pay-per-view, and subscriptions. As the program kicks off, all content will be free, with some video supported by advertising.

“TiVo subscribers will gain access to the largest, most powerful content platform ever offered — the Internet. If it’s on Brightcove, you’ll be able to watch it on your TV using your TiVo box,” said Brightcove founder and CEO Jeremy Allaire in a statement. The partnership will also eventually let users search for video through their PC and save it to their TiVo box to watch at their leisure. TiVo subscribers will also be able to discover Brightcove video through the TiVo Central content management system on their set-top boxes.
